Output 16b3cfafac76255e766a687b16f2f9c74b9b508594f34e0c695626c97007a05a:3

value
1479249
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 84af9448e6b4f4f62e39ed65d181e0d79d24b0e1 OP_EQUALVERIFY OP_CHECKSIG
address
1D6aXnHwuZxn4MXCAoUkyBRrRzDLVBxNxJ
transaction
16b3cfafac76255e766a687b16f2f9c74b9b508594f34e0c695626c97007a05a
spent
true